Portola was not able to break out of their rough patch on Tuesday as the team picked up their third straight loss. They fell just short of the Chester Volcanoes by a score of 11-9. The result was an unpleasant reminder to Portola of the 12-2 defeat they experienced in the pair's previous head-to-head fixture back in April of 2023.
Johnny Stewart was cooking despite his team's loss, scoring three runs while going 2-for-3. Another player making a difference was Tanner Carr, who scored three runs while going 2-for-4.
On Chester's side, Jacob Dowling made a big impact no matter where he played. He struck out seven batters over six innings while giving up three earned (and two unearned) runs off seven hits. Dowling has been nothing but reliable on the mound: he hasn't given up more than two walks in five consecutive pitching appearances. Dowling was also solid in the batter's box, scoring a run and stealing a base while going 2-for-4.
In other batting news, Jax Holland was incredible, getting on base in four of his five plate appearances with a home run, two runs, and a stolen base. Chase Clark was another key contributor, going 2-for-3 with two RBI and a double.
Portola's loss dropped their record down to 7-12. As for Chester, they are on a roll lately: they've won eight of their last nine games, which provided a massive bump to their 11-5 record this season.
